Farm goods in Budapest
Farm goods store opened in Budapest on Saturday. The shop aims to market only farms producing food, produced by the farmers.
Chladek Tibor, creator and owner of the shop, that situates in the 18th district of Budapest in the Havana residental estate, said to MTI, that there are no plans to open additional stores, but if the company will be successful, the establishment of a network marketing farm products is possible.
The shop will try to keep the prices low, but of course there will be examples, that some products can not compete with the discount prices of the large retail chains – reports ProfitLine.hu.
